linux 删除软连接命令
在Linux系统下,删除软连接的命令是什么呢?长沙家政网为您详细解析。
在Linux系统下,删除软连接的命令是`rm -rf`。软连接,也被称为符号链接或symlink,是一种特殊的文件,它指向另一个文件或目录。创建软连接使用的是`ln -s`命令,例如:`ln -s /usr/hb/ /home/hb_link`。
要删除这个软连接,正确的命令是`rm -rf hb_link`。需要注意的是,命令中的“rf”参数意味着“递归删除文件夹”和“强制删除”,所以请务必谨慎使用。如果命令误写为`rm -rf hb_link/`,将会删除整个目录,这是一个非常危险的操作。
那么,如何正确地删除一个链接文件呢?使用命令`rm /home/hb_link`即可,这里只是少了一个末尾的斜线“/”,这样删除的就是链接文件本身。
拓展一下关于Linux链接的知识。链接是共享文件和访问它的用户的若干目录项之间建立联系的一种方法。Linux中的链接分为硬链接和符号链接两种。默认情况下,`ln`命令产生的是硬链接。
硬链接是通过索引节点来进行连接的。在Linux文件系统中,每个文件都有一个唯一的索引节点号(Inode Index)。多个文件名可以指向同一索引节点,这种连接就是硬连接。硬连接的主要作用是防止“误删”重要的文件,因为即使删除了一个硬连接,文件的数据块及目录的连接也不会被释放,只有当与之相关的所有硬连接文件均被删除后,文件才会被真正删除。
而符号链接(软链接)则是一个特殊的文件,它包含另一文件的位置信息,类似于Windows中的快捷方式。软链接实际上是一个文本文件,记录了目标文件或目录的路径。
以上就是长沙家政网小编今天的分享,希望能对大家有所帮助。无论是硬链接还是软链接,都是Linux文件系统中的重要概念,正确使用它们可以更好地管理文件和目录。